[*]Cannot pick up items

[*]Cannot buy/sell items at npc (opening the trade windows is okay tho)

[*]Do not gain experience

[*]Cannot use skills

disable_pickup
disable_store
disable_exp
disable_skill_usage

On my side, I made an unequippable headgear which weighed 111% the original GM's weight capacity, and assigned it to the GM via the DB then removed any statpoint left. This way the GM had all those permissions applied because it was 1/1 novice without even basic skills.

 
I am personally not too fond of the idea, not that its bad, but it kind of feels like somethings are being pushed a bit too far in regards to customization. 

I am fine with some new features and what not, but I don't think it is that much of a good idea to add every feature (For as useful as it can be) cluttering up the code with not-so-much-deal-breaking configurations/options.

With the plugin system and any improvements it might have in the future, adding custom modifications is only going to be a matter of minutes, so everyone can freely mess up or overcomplicate their own installation without overcluttering the code with stuff that might not be really needed by most people.

Please note though, this particular change might not be too big to add (And my comment is not regarding this particular suggestion, but more of a common thing), but its just I've been seeing some "Make this a builtin feature" more and more often everyday...
